1957 Austin Princess vs. 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190

To start off, 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190 is newer by 33 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1957 Austin Princess.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1957 Austin Princess would be higher. At 3,992 cc (6 cylinders), 1957 Austin Princess is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190 (235 HP @ 7200 RPM) has 117 more horse power than 1957 Austin Princess. (118 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190 should accelerate faster than 1957 Austin Princess.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1957 Austin Princess weights approximately 840 kg more than 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1957 Austin Princess (251 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 5 more torque (in Nm) than 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190. (246 Nm @ 5000 RPM). This means 1957 Austin Princess will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190.

Compare all specifications:

1957 Austin Princess 1990 Mercedes-Benz 190
Make Austin Mercedes-Benz
Model Princess 190
Year Released 1957 1990
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3992 cc 2461 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 118 HP 235 HP
Engine RPM 4000 RPM 7200 RPM
Torque 251 Nm 246 Nm
Torque RPM 2000 RPM 5000 RPM
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Vehicle Weight 2180 kg 1340 kg
Vehicle Length 5470 mm 4550 mm
Vehicle Width 1900 mm 1730 mm
Vehicle Height 1780 mm 1350 mm
Wheelbase Size 3360 mm 2670 mm
